A private-use tag like "x-ident" (or even "x-id") would probably be more 
precise for Peter's purpose than one of the subtags or tags in the LSR, 
none of which has exactly the meaning he wants to convey.  But a PU tag 
only has meaning within the private agreement (which of course can be 
publicized widely, just not in the LSR) and Peter may feel this is not 
formal enough.
